Premier league soul man Z.Z. Hill's US Kent tenure did
not bring him huge commercial success, but the
recordings he made for the company provided the
catalyst for the R&B/Soul hits he would have during the
70s and his reinvention as a standard bearer for
'Bluesoul' in the early 80s.
He recorded prolifically for the label for four years,
issuing more than a dozen singles and two albums
containing soul music of the highest quality. Ace has
been reissuing Z.Z.'s repertoire on the UK Kent imprint
ever since we started representing Kent/Modern, more
than 30 years ago. We are delighted to kick off 2018
with "That's It!", a 2CD anthology that finally brings
everything the man recorded for the US Kent label
together in one place.
CD1 contains the A and B-sides of all of Z.Z.'s original
US Kent 45s in chronological order and in mono, as
they were heard at the time. Many of these mono mixes
are making their UK Kent debut. CD2 contains Z.Z.'s
'concept' album "A Whole Lot Of Soul" in stereo (again
released for the first time on CD in its entirety), plus
tracks and significant remixes released after Z.Z. left
the label - including a few that are also new to UK Kent
- again, mostly in stereo.
